Output 445e59255731616a5babc06ccdef186324863be6f9bf7def444f6b52ae6c788a:189

value
118468
script pubkey
OP_0 OP_PUSHBYTES_32 8966a9a83dfcf044ca9e574175d7486e9ebdf40e6e2b8768b80e18dc72a91d9e
address
bc1q39n2n2palncyfj572aqht46gd60tmaqwdc4cw69cpcvdcu4frk0qj3rq2e
transaction
445e59255731616a5babc06ccdef186324863be6f9bf7def444f6b52ae6c788a
confirmations
64844
spent
true